TOGA BUILDING COMPANY PTY LTD v KARHUGH PTY LTD SUPREME COURT OF NEW SOUTH WALES — COURT OF APPEAL
MAHONEY JA 19 April 1993
[1993] NSWCA 270
Mahoney JA. This is an application for a stay of execution upon a judgment pending the determination of the appeal.
On 9 March 1993 McInerney J gave judgment for the plaintiff against the two defendants, Karhugh Pty Ltd and Toga Building Company Pty Ltd The judgment was given upon the basis that his Honour found each of the defendants to be negligent. His Honour apportioned the amount of the damages which he proposed to award, namely, $329,784.64, between the two defendants, the first defendant to pay $230,849.25 and the second defendant $98,935.39. However, as I understand the effect of the judgment, having regard to the findings of negligence that the judge made, each of the defendants would be liable to the plaintiff for the full amount of the judgment, but the amount which as between themselves they would have to bear would be apportioned as his Honour indicated.
Application has been made by the Toga Company for a stay of execution. The position is rather more complicated than itnormally would appear, for at least two reasons. The first of them is that I understand formal judgment has not yet been entered. In saying this I do not direct criticism to the parties. The position appears to be that, on the contention of the Toga Company, it suggested that the judge, although he apportioned the liability for the judgment in the manner to which I have referred, did not in his judgment refer to the reasons why he apportioned the amount in this way; in particular he did not refer to, as it is contended, contractual indemnities or other matters operative as between the parties upon the basis of which, as I infer, Toga would suggest that it should not have been liable at all or at least for a lesser amount.
